Professional photographers' magazine in October

The first issue of The Lensman, a new magazine catering to the professional photographic market, should be out the first week of October 2011, just in time for the Photo and Film Expo at The Dome in Johannesburg. It will come out in alternate months with a print run of 3800 copies.

It will use the B2B model. "We toyed with the idea of going retail," says managing editor Gavin Smith, "but advertisers are looking for a more direct route to their customer. The 'spray and pray' approach is no longer all that attractive in specialised industries.

"Nothing comparable on the market"

"The trend we have seen develop over the last few years is a move to far more focused marketing strategies aimed at specific decision makers in a given market. It is with this in mind we decided to launch the mag as in our opinion there is nothing comparable on the market at the moment.

Continues Smith, "The main feature in the first issue will be a preview of the expo. Coupled to this, we will be doing the first in a series called 'Shoot of the month', which will take a look at the challenges associated with in-studio, and location shoots and offer advice from professionals who have been on the front line. The rest of the mag will be a mixture of news, views, features and products and anything else that adds value."

Focusing on professionals

"We are not focusing on the point and shoot industry, but the professionals out there. Coupled to that, we will be putting the mag into the hands of decision makers at all the mass retails stores, educational institutions, professional photographers, ad agencies and PR companies.

"This database will expand and evolve as we grow into the industry and our long term goal is to get an issue out to market every month. This mag is the culmination of the efforts of a small and passionate group and we are both excited and nervous to see how the market reacts," he concludes.
